The National Stock Exchange (NSE) on June 12, 2026, issued the notification regarding the Mock trading from BCP/DR site on Saturday, June 13, 2026.
The following has been stated namely: -
• Mock Trading Schedule (13 June 2026)
o Primary Site: 09:00 AM – 11:00 AM
o BCP/DR Site: 11:45 AM – 05:00 PM
o Trade modification allowed until 05:30 PM.
• Members must perform a live re-login from the Primary Site between 06:30 PM and 07:00 PM to avoid login issues on June 15, 2026.
• NSE will switch from the Primary Site to the DR/BCP Site through a non-graceful shutdown.
• All outstanding orders will be purged before BCP trading starts.
• NNF users must manually clear Session-1 orders in their systems.
• Connectivity & Software
o No changes are required in NEAT Adapter settings.
o Software versions:
a. NEAT Version: 3.5.4
b. NEAT Adapter: 1.0.29 / 1.0.27
• Existing User IDs, IPs, and Box IDs can be used.
• Operational Guidelines
o Mock trades have no financial settlement obligations (no pay-in/pay-out).
o Only valid and approved UCC/PAN records will be accepted.
o NOTIS will be available during the mock session.
o Connect2NSE and Extranet will be unavailable during specified maintenance windows.
• After DR Switchover
• Primary-site trades remain visible in the Previous Trades window.
• Trades can still be modified/cancelled through the respective windows.
• Primary-site messages remain available in the TWS Message Area.
• If the NEAT User folder is deleted or renamed before re-login, this historical data will not be available.
